5. Bismarkcito Malecón
Bismarkcito, located right on the iconic Malecón of La Paz, Baja California Sur, is a beloved seafood institution that has been serving locals and visitors for over 50 years. This long-standing restaurant is deeply rooted in tradition and has built a reputation for quality, consistency, and an unbeatable coastal vibe. Whether you’re stopping by for a relaxed lunch, a sunset dinner with friends, or a casual meal with family, Bismarkcito offers an authentic Baja seafood experience in one of the city’s most picturesque locations. The ocean breeze, the sound of waves, and the lively yet laid-back energy of the Malecón all add to the charm.
With prices ranging from $250 to $600 MXN per person, Bismarkcito remains an accessible option without compromising on freshness or flavor. It’s a go-to spot for anyone looking to enjoy top-quality seafood in a setting that feels genuinely local. The pet-friendly policy is another major plus, allowing diners to relax outdoors with their furry friends while taking in views of the Sea of Cortez. The casual atmosphere makes it an easy choice for everything from spontaneous weekday lunches to weekend gatherings.
The menu is a celebration of Baja’s seafood bounty, offering a wide variety of dishes that highlight the region’s flavors. Think zesty ceviches, rich shrimp cocktails, crispy fish tacos, and the famous “almejas chocolatas” (chocolate clams), a local delicacy. Coconut shrimp and seafood tostadas are also among the top picks, balancing crisp textures with bold, refreshing tastes. The drink menu complements the coastal fare perfectly, with local beers, micheladas, and classic cocktails that round out the experience with a splash of Baja sunshine.

9. Restaurante Quemadero La Paz
Restaurante Quemadero, located in La Paz, Baja California Sur, delivers a true northern-style grill experience, spotlighting wood-fired cooking and bold, smoky flavors that define its rustic charm. This local favorite stands out for its commitment to quality ingredients, many sourced from the region, and for offering a welcoming space that feels both casual and authentic. Whether you’re gathering with family, enjoying a laid-back dinner with friends, or planning a date night with a relaxed twist, Quemadero is the go-to spot for those craving hearty, flame-kissed dishes in the capital of Baja Sur.
With a price range of $300 to $700 MXN per person, Quemadero is an accessible option that doesn’t compromise on flavor or quality. The pet-friendly patio is a big plus, inviting guests to enjoy the warm, open-air setting alongside their dogs. The ambiance is simple yet inviting—wood accents, open grills, and the scent of mesquite smoke in the air create the perfect backdrop for a no-frills, flavor-forward meal. It’s the kind of place where the food speaks for itself and the vibe keeps you coming back.
The menu centers around grilled meats and seafood, with standout items like rib-eye, arrachera, grilled shrimp tacos, and juicy beef ribs. Everything is cooked over charcoal, giving each dish a deep, smoky character that elevates even the simplest ingredients. The shrimp tacos, in particular, are a local favorite—perfectly charred and bursting with flavor. The drink menu features craft beers and refreshing cocktails, all curated to pair well with the intensity of the grill. Whether you’re a meat lover or a seafood fan, there’s something on the menu to satisfy every craving.
